Output 451ec076e8e12150f07e4c0e84c7a3344423d28af9e7c3f8cd339f7e98b24955:3

value
28851621
script pubkey
OP_0 OP_PUSHBYTES_20 5e86fcbd3985fa029b64ad5acccd7a48d4f9af6c
address
ltc1qt6r0e0feshaq9xmy44dvent6fr20ntmvw3zaf8
transaction
451ec076e8e12150f07e4c0e84c7a3344423d28af9e7c3f8cd339f7e98b24955
spent
true